A porcelain vase
Designed by Edouard Colonna, manufactured by Gerard, Dufraiseiix and Abbott, Limoges, circa 1900/2
Slender shouldered body moulded in low relief with peacock feathers, heightened with white slip-trailing, pierced base
12 3/8in. (31.5cm.) high
Underside with finely painted number in red 82/204

拍品专文

Cf: Gerald P. Weisberg, Art Nouveau Bing, 1986, p. 263, the example from the permanent collection of the Musée des Arts Décoratifs, Paris, reproduced.
